Franceville/ Masuku vs Santiago Climate & Distance Between

Chile flag
  • The distance between Franceville/ Masuku, Gabon and Santiago, Chile is approximately 9,376 km or 5,826 mi.
  • To reach Franceville/ Masuku in this distance one would set out from Santiago bearing 88.2°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Franceville/ Masuku bearing 56.5° or ENE .
  • Franceville/ Masuku has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Santiago has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
  • Franceville/ Masuku is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Santiago is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 10.9 °C (19.5°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.4 °C (18.7°F) less in Franceville/ Masuku.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1574.4 mm (62 in) more which is equivalent to 1574.4 l/m² (38.64 US gal/ft²) or 15,744,000 l/ha (1,683,138 US gal/ac) more. About 7 as much.
  • There are 853 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Franceville/ Masuku. In whichever way circa 2h 20' less per day or about 2/3 as many.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.7° higher in Franceville/ Masuku than in Santiago.
  • Relative humidity levels are 2% lower.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 10.2°C (18.3°F) higher.
